Can AI replace Teachers? Comparing AI and Human Teachers’ ratings and feedback on students’ essays

<title>Abstract</title> <p>This study aimed to evaluate the consistency between human and AI-generated ratings on ESL student essays and to compare the manner and focus of their feedback. Using a standardized rubric, three human raters and three AI tools assessed essays based on content, organization, language, and mechanics.
